Description
The new edition of this thought-provoking work expresses the opinion that a considerable portion of the Muslim Law with special reference to law of marriage and talak has failed to consort with the spirit of the Constitution. It advocates the introduction of a Uniform Civil Code as prescribed by Art. 44 of the Constitution. It is hoped that the work remains as useful as it was in its earlier editions.
